Welcome to the TEACH Portal, which houses all of your learning experiences for the Trainee Education in Advocacy and Community Health curriculum. The overall goal of the TEACH curriculum is to increase the ability of clinicians to understand, identify, and address the effects of child poverty in a primary care setting. With 1 in 5 children in the United States living in poverty, it is critical that we can recognize, mitigate, and empathize with the effects of child poverty. The curriculum integrates e-learning, clinical experiences, and community-based experiences to help you reach these goals.
